[Northeast] MI424WR wireless goes dead after 1-2 minutes between

$
0
0
For the past week or so, my Actiontec router has been going dead on the wireless. If I reboot the router, or even just log in to the router at 192.168.1.1 and toggle the Wireless off and then back on, my wireless network comes back to life... But within 5 minutes tops, it goes dead again. The router light is blinking green the whole time, but none of my wireless devices can see each other in a home network, nor access the Internet through the router. The wired ethernet connections work fine. The multi-room DVR service can be a bit spotty now though. Too bad for me my only printer is a wireless one! I've spent 4-5 rounds with Verizon tech support, I've changed my Wireless channel from 1 to 11, hard reset my router any number of times and even had my ONT rebooted ("just to see what happens"), and swapped out my router twice. First for another Rev F, and then I actually paid $$ to get a Rev I version of the MI424WR with two antennas. Nothing has helped. I had used this service for 3+ years with no issues until this hit, and now it won't go away, even though it seems like a hardware problem. Any suggestions? I'm not waiting another 1+ hours to talk to a Verizon tech again to get the same scripted answers! I am running the power to the router through a CyberPower 685AVR line conditioner and UPS, and have tried both running the coax ethernet through the AVR and directly from the wall to the router, and even removing the router from the AVR and straight to the wall (in case my AVR has started flaking out and providing spiky voltage). Nope, plus none of the other devices plugged into the AVR exhibit any kind of power fluctuation issues.
